Thread: Escape Processing problems
Hi all, The Connection.EscapeSQL() routine is broken IMHO . Actually, I'm not sure why it is trying to fix strings starting with "{d" in the first place? Anyway, currently I've turned it off in the statement with setEscapeProcessing(false) The problem I'm having is that "{d" appears in the data that I'm trying to store and its not a date. So data like the following... .....blahhh}; {blahhh }; {docs=""}; is turning into... .....blahhh}; {blahhh }; ocs="" ; ^^ ^ What's more is if I have something like "{d....." and there is no ending brace, it will throw a StringIndexOutOfBoundsException as the return value of the indexOf() looking for the closing brace will not find one and thus setCharAt() will use an illegal index of -1 :( The routine is below for reference... Can anyone explain why it is trying to do this on me in the first place. I would think escape processing would do something a little different like watching my single quotes etc. public String EscapeSQL(String sql) { //if (DEBUG) { System.out.println ("parseSQLEscapes called"); } // If we find a "{d", assume we have a date escape. // // Since the date escape syntax is very close to the // native Postgres date format, we just remove the escape // delimiters. // // This implementation could use some optimization, but it has // worked in practice for two years of solid use. int index = sql.indexOf("{d"); while (index != -1) { //System.out.println ("escape found at index: " + index); StringBuffer buf = new StringBuffer(sql); buf.setCharAt(index, ' '); buf.setCharAt(index + 1, ' '); buf.setCharAt(sql.indexOf('}', index), ' '); sql = new String(buf); index = sql.indexOf("{d"); } //System.out.println ("modified SQL: " + sql); return sql; } Cheers, Tom. -- Thomas O'Dowd. - Nooping - http://nooper.com tom@nooper.com - Testing - http://nooper.co.jp/labs
Thomas, This is doing exactly what it is supposed to according to the JDBC Spec. Hi Barry, I found the part in the spec that talks about escape processing for date and time. Thanks for pointing that out. I believe the drivers implementation is wrong as it is a) changing random text data instead of data of a defined format to its escape sequence and b) it can throw a out of bounds exception if there is no closing }. Perhaps, I'll write a patch later in the day to fix this for at least the date escape as that is the only one that is implemented. So just to clarify my understanding of what should happen... "SELECT a, b from c where t={d 'yyyy-mm-dd'} and a=1" should be changed to: "SELECT a, b from c where t='yyyy-mm-dd' and a=1" and something like "INSERT INTO test VALUES('don't change this {d 'yyyy-mm-dd'} as its correct. " should be left alone. ie, if we're in a string escape processing should not be done. Right now it looks for anything with {d in the query and starts changing it. Cheers, Tom. Hi all, I'm attaching a patch which fixes the corruption in strings caused by escape processing in the SQL statement. I've tested this for a while now and it appears to work well. Previously string data with {d was getting corrupt as the {d was being stripped regardless of whether it was an escape code or not. I also added checking for time and timestamp escape processing strings as per 11.3 in the specification. The patch is against the latest CVS. Cheers, Tom.
Attachment
Hi all, Wonder if anyone had a look at this patch yet? I've been using my locally patched version for a while now and it works fine. Again just to make it clear what it does... - It fixes an Exception which will be thrown with the following insert. insert into bbbb values ('xxxx{d'); - The current statement implementation also corrupts string data with '{d' characters by removing them. This patch fixes this. - The patch also adds support for {t and {ts escapes which are covered in section 11.3 of the specification. Does anyone on the list use these types of escapes??? Right now I'm mostly after fixing the corruption of strings as a lot of my data contains the "{d" character combination and its quite annoying. For those of you who don't know, the escapeSQL() method is called everytime you execute a Statement or PreparedStatement if setEscapeProcessing is set true (which is the default). Tom.
